Output 580aa1f88fd52f91762563680de60a678f4094fd9e6e39a06ba9ac51f5e7f65e:1

value
46838378
script pubkey
OP_0 OP_PUSHBYTES_20 23c619586add6b8a1261e04bdf6285422b198ccb
address
tb1qy0rpjkr2m44c5ynpup9a7c59gg43nrxtyr8vp8
transaction
580aa1f88fd52f91762563680de60a678f4094fd9e6e39a06ba9ac51f5e7f65e
confirmations
30728
spent
true